
What is recorded here
Indicated as an irregularly shaped enclosure (max. dims. c. 54m) on the 1st (1839) ed. and as roughly pentagonal on the 1947 revision, with a field boundary running NE-SW along the edge of the NW sector, a field boundary running NE from the NE sector and another running roughly ENE from the SE sector. Only the NW-N-NE perimeter of the monument is retained in a field boundary, the remainder of the enclosure E-S-W has been levelled. The fosse (Wth c. 3m) is visible as a cropmark on satellite imagery (Google Earth, imagery date 25 April 2021)
